    I recently tried out the McKee's High Performance Glass Restorer (from Autogeek) and followed it up with Aquapel. The results blew me away.

    I took a road trip last week. The windshield was COVERED in bug splatter from 4 hours of night time driving. I mean totally covered. I never tried clearing them with the windshield wipers.

    Well, I forgot to wash the windshield after arrival at my destination and the bugs BAKED in 90° heat and direct sunlight for 4 days.

    Before coming home, I hit the glass with some run of the mill glass cleaner and to my surprise... the bugs wiped off effortlessly! I've used each product independently before but never back to back. It must have been the deep cleaning with the glass restorer that allowed a really good bonding of the Aquapel. The results with the bug splatter was nothing short of remarkable.

    If you deal with bugs and summer heat... try this combo!

    On a dry windshield they'll chatter. In rain, no chatter, unless you just don't have enough water on the glass. Even then it's not bad. The beading of Aquapel is totally different than rainX. It's not quite as fast rolling but much better and more clear. No hazing as it wears like rainX does.

    It is a semi-permanent coating that’s why. It is nothing like cheapo Rain-X.

    Which is why you should use with care. Coatings can mean you can never do a chip repair on the coated glass, because the adhesive they use will just come right out.

    Between applications I would polish the glass like you did. Helps prevent a build up of the product.
